Контур.Диадок — различия между версиями

Материал из Wiki AlterOS
Перейти к: навигация, поиск
Строка 6: Строка 6:
 
1. В папке /opt/kontur.plugin/ переименуйте файл kontur.plugin.host в kontur.plugin.host.real  
 
1. В папке /opt/kontur.plugin/ переименуйте файл kontur.plugin.host в kontur.plugin.host.real  
  
2. В папку /opt/kontur.plugin/ скопируйте файл kontur.plugin.host из вложения к инциденту
+
2. В папке /opt/kontur.plugin/ создайте файл kontur.plugin.host
  
3. Дайте ему права на исполнение одним из способов:
+
Это можно сделать с помощью команды:
 +
 +
$ sudo vim /opt/kontur.plugin/kontur.plugin.host
  
а) ИЛИ ПКМ по файлу -> Свойства -> вкладка "Права" и поставьте галку "Разрешить исполнять как программу" (пример)
+
Далее вставляем текст со следующим содержимым:
 +
 
 +
#!/bin/bash
 +
LD_PRELOAD=/opt/cprocsp/lib/amd64/libcapi20.so /opt/kontur.plugin/kontur.plugin.host.real
 +
 +
# альтернатива
 +
# LD_PRELOAD=/opt/kontur.plugin/pkcs11/libjcPKCS11-2.so /opt/kontur.plugin/kontur.plugin.host.real
 +
 
 +
После этого нажимаем '''ESC''', пишем в редакторе ''':x''', чтобы сохранить и выйти.
 +
 
 +
3. Дайте файлу '''kontur.plugin.host.real''' права на исполнение одним из способов:
 +
 
 +
а) ИЛИ ''ПКМ по файлу -> Свойства -> вкладка '''Права''''' и поставьте галку '''Разрешить исполнять как программу''' (пример)
 
         [[Файл:Свойства kontur.plugin.host.png]]
 
         [[Файл:Свойства kontur.plugin.host.png]]
  
б) ИЛИ перейдите в терминале в папку /opt/kontur.plugin/ командой cd /opt/kontur.plugin/ и выполните sudo chmod +x ./kontur.plugin.host
+
б) ИЛИ перейдите в терминале в папку /opt/kontur.plugin/ командой '''cd /opt/kontur.plugin/''' и выполните '''sudo chmod +x ./kontur.plugin.host'''
  
 
4. Обновите страницу входа в сервис.
 
4. Обновите страницу входа в сервис.

Версия 13:32, 20 февраля 2023

Не работает вход в Контур.Диадок по сертификату

Если при настройке рабочего места, после установки плагина и расширения для браузера были установлены сертификаты, но снова возникает окно настройки рабочего места, то для решения ошибки, необходимо:

1. В папке /opt/kontur.plugin/ переименуйте файл kontur.plugin.host в kontur.plugin.host.real

2. В папке /opt/kontur.plugin/ создайте файл kontur.plugin.host

Это можно сделать с помощью команды:

$ sudo vim /opt/kontur.plugin/kontur.plugin.host

Далее вставляем текст со следующим содержимым:

#!/bin/bash
LD_PRELOAD=/opt/cprocsp/lib/amd64/libcapi20.so /opt/kontur.plugin/kontur.plugin.host.real

# альтернатива
# LD_PRELOAD=/opt/kontur.plugin/pkcs11/libjcPKCS11-2.so /opt/kontur.plugin/kontur.plugin.host.real

После этого нажимаем ESC, пишем в редакторе :x, чтобы сохранить и выйти.

3. Дайте файлу kontur.plugin.host.real права на исполнение одним из способов:

а) ИЛИ ПКМ по файлу -> Свойства -> вкладка Права и поставьте галку Разрешить исполнять как программу (пример)

        Свойства kontur.plugin.host.png

б) ИЛИ перейдите в терминале в папку /opt/kontur.plugin/ командой cd /opt/kontur.plugin/ и выполните sudo chmod +x ./kontur.plugin.host

4. Обновите страницу входа в сервис.